What Happens in a Musical Theatre Class at Footsteps?

At Footsteps Dance School, our musical theatre classes in Sale take place at Sale High School and are led by Miss Cara, a passionate and experienced teacher with a specialism in tap and musical theatre. These weekly term-time sessions are designed to be welcoming, energetic, and inclusive, giving children the chance to experience the joy of theatrical performance in a supportive environment.

While musical theatre is traditionally a blend of singing, acting, and dancing, at Footsteps, the focus is firmly on dance and movement inspired by stage productions. Here’s what children can expect during class:

Choreography Inspired by Musicals

Every session includes high-energy dance routines drawn from well-known musicals and theatre styles. These routines are:

  • Taught in age-appropriate, ability-based groups

  • Focused on rhythm, storytelling through movement, and expressive choreography

  • Designed to encourage confidence, coordination, and stage presence

Children work together to learn sequences that reflect the style and flair of musical theatre, with plenty of encouragement and hands-on support from our teaching team.

Building Towards Performance

Over time, children work on choreographed routines that may form part of:

  • Our school-wide dance shows, held every 18 months

  • Themed internal showcases within class

  • End-of-week dance camp performances (during school holidays)

These performances give children the chance to experience the excitement of the stage while building valuable teamwork and rehearsal skills.
